@capitoltrace/mcp-server

Congressional intelligence for AI assistants. Connect Claude, GPT, or any MCP-compatible AI to real-time legislative data from 21+ government sources.

Quick Start

1. Get an API Key

Visit capitoltrace.com/developers and sign up for a free key.

2. Add to Claude Desktop

Add to your Claude Desktop config (~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json on Mac, %APPDATA%\Claude\claude_desktop_config.json on Windows):

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"capitoltrace": {
      "command": "npx",
      "args": ["-y", "@capitoltrace/mcp-server"],
      "env": {
        "CAPITOLTRACE_API_KEY": "ct_live_your_key_here"
      }
    }
  }
}

3. Restart Claude Desktop

Fully quit and reopen. You'll see Capitol Trace tools available.

Available Tools (12)

| Tool | Description | Tier | |------|-------------|------| | search_members | Search 538 members by name, state, party, chamber | Free | | get_member_profile | Full dossier: terms, leadership, legislation | Free | | get_member_trades | Stock trades with STOCK Act compliance | Researcher | | get_member_donors | Campaign finance, PAC %, grassroots score | Researcher | | get_member_votes | Roll call voting record | Free | | get_member_ideology | DW-NOMINATE, bipartisan score, party unity | Researcher | | search_lobbying | Senate LDA filings by client, firm, issue | Researcher | | get_signals | AI-detected correlations (trades + votes + lobbying) | Free | | search_bills | Legislation search | Free | | get_executive_orders | Executive orders from Federal Register | Free | | get_stock_alerts | Late disclosures and suspicious patterns | Free | | compare_members | Side-by-side comparison of two members | Free |
